Boot Scooter

A boot scooter is a Class 2 mobility scooter that is folded or taken apart to be transported in the back of a car. They can be used on roads and indoors, and are ideal for those who frequently travel.

They can be folded up and taken apart in a matter of minutes without the use of tools. They are lightweight and easily transportable by car.

Easy to transport

If you're taking your mobility scooter, or planning to buy one for yourself, the best way to reap the most from your investment is to find an simple-to-transport option. A boot scooter, also known as a travel scooter is a compact model of scooter that folds up and easily fits into the car's boot, making it easy to take wherever you go.

If you're not sure what type of scooter you require, it is best to visit a local store and try different models in a controlled environment. It's also a good idea to speak to a product adviser who can assist you in choosing the right mobility scooter for your requirements.

A quality boot-scooter should be light and easy to disassemble so that you can put it into your car with no hassle. The Liberty Vogue is an excellent model of a lightweight, car-transportable scooter. It can be disassembled into five pieces in less than 30 minutes. This makes it a great choice for anyone looking to load their mobility scooter quickly and easily into the trunk of the car.
